Rishabh Pant ‘babysits’ Tim Paine’s kids

Bonnie Paine, wife of the Australian captain, posts photo with Rishabh Pant and her kids on Instagram

The current India-Australia series has had its share of verbal exchanges on the field, but the one thing it has certainly not been found lacking in is a sense of humour. With the ethics and behaviour of this Australian side being under scrutiny following the ball-tampering scandal, the players had to put on a more sanitised front when they took the field during their home season. But that didn’t stop television producers from cranking up the stump microphones to get a feel of the chatter. And the players have given scribes some tasty spin-off stories over the last three Tests.

At the forefront is Tim Paine, Australia’s stand-in captain following Steve Smith’s ban. Paine’s been busy behind the stumps engaging with Rohit Sharma and Rishabh Pant, trying to distract them while batting.

The latest side story that has got social media talking is an Instagram story posted on Tuesday by Tim’s wife Bonnie. She posted a picture of Pant holding one of her kids, she holding the other, with the caption “Best babysitter @rishabpant”, at the Australian Prime Minister Scott Morrison’s residence.

During the Melbourne Test, Paine helped himself to some lighthearted sledging on Pant, one of the juniormost members of the squad. Paine reminded Pant of his omission from the one-day international squad, suggesting that the young, aggressive wicketkeeper could join him for the Hobart Hurricanes in the ongoing Big Bash League.

“Hits sixes and fours for fun,” said Paine from behind the stumps. “Big MS (Dhoni) is back in the one-day squad too, we might get him (Pant) down to the (Hobart) Hurricanes this bloke. We need a batter.

 

“Fancy that, Pantsy? Surely, extend your little Aussie holiday. Beautiful town Hobart too, I’ll get you a nice apartment on the waterfront. (I’ll) have him over for dinner. Can you babysit? I’ll take the wife to the movies one night and you’ll look after the kids.”

Later in the Test, when Paine came out to bat, Pant seized an opportunity to give it back.

“We got a special guest today,” quipped Pant. “Have you ever heard of a temporary captain, ever?

He (Paine) loves to talk that’s the only thing he can do.”

 

If Pant does indeed take up Paine’s job offer, his kids would have a “special guest” at home.
